autosave components in Longmanhill, Banff, Banffshire
-
- 1
-
Email
-
Reviews
Autosave Components
Local Car Accessories in Longmanhill, Banff, Banffshire01343 55510001343 55510052.5 miles -
- 2
-
Email
-
Reviews
Autosave Components
Local Car Accessories in Longmanhill, Banff, Banffshire01463 71364601463 713646108 miles
1 - 2 of 2
Loading more results...
